What will be done on Windows "Mango" Phone?

Microsoft has unveiled its future platform widely Windows Phone "Mango", but the physical characteristics of the second generation of Windows expected in the autumn Phone remain mysterious. It is currently only sure of one thing: they possess a Qualcomm Snapdragon processor. It is the executive vice president of Qualcomm, which states: "Qualcomm is excited about the idea to market a new generation of Windows phone equipped exclusively with the second generation of processors Qualcom Snapdragon.

"What is this second generation of Snapdragon? The current Windows phone all boarded the same SoC: a Qualcomm QSD8250. The ARM processor is a Snapdragon "Scorpion" single-core 1 GHz, the integrated GPU is a Adreno 200. This chip was exceeded by at Qualcomm 8x55, equipped with a GPU 205 Adreno announced twice as powerful as the Adreno 200.

Since early 2011, Qualcomm delivers 8x60 family, the first dual-core Snapdragon. The architecture of the CPU does not change (heart Scorpio), but their frequency can reach 1.5 GHz. These SoC also boarded a GPU Adreno 220, still twice as powerful as the 205 and Adreno are four times more potent than 200 of Adreno Windows phone.

Then the Mango Phone Do they have 8x55 or 8x60? Unfortunately, if one grows a document leaked in mid-April (the cons), it will be satisfied with the 8x55. Microsoft would also allow the use of MSM 7x30, which are MSM8x55 which the CPU is idling at 800 MHz. Hopefully, however, Microsoft is encouraging manufacturers to launch dual-core models: Windows Phone needs spearheads able to compete with the best Android or iPhone.
